The report outlines the performance of the Západoslovenská energetika (ZSE) Group for the fiscal year 2024, marking its first full year of integrated operations across Eastern and Western Slovakia. The company increased its energy network investments by 10% to EUR 228 million, focusing on distribution systems and smart grid projects like ACON and Danube InGrid. ZSE also expanded its e-mobility network, ZSE Drive, by adding 192 charging points, and successfully procured liquefied natural gas to diversify supply. Furthermore, the group initiated its first consolidated sustainability reporting under European ESRS standards, identifying 26 material topics and setting ambitious decarbonization targets.
